Goodluck Jonathan's Eligibility for 2027 Presidency Sparks Debate

The debate over Goodluck Jonathan's eligibility to run for Nigeria's presidency in 2027 is heating up. Jonathan, a former president, seeks a potential return to the ballot after serving from 2010 to 2015.
His rise to power began in 2007, and he voluntarily left office in 2015 after losing the election. With the 2023 election trend in mind, the legal conundrum of his eligibility remains a key issue.
Jonathan's political journey, starting as deputy governor in 1999, has been marked by twists and turns, including his unexpected rise to the presidency. The possibility of his return to the political scene has sparked discussions and speculations among Nigerians.
